5. Vincent Kompany
Top defender for Manchester City, his spell as a player was brought down by injury, bringing retirement so early. Despite his remarkable achievements, including four Premier League titles, Kompany battled numerous setbacks, missing a total of 176 matches due to 31 different injuries.

4. Jack Wilshere
![most injury prone players](https://footballdebates.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/07/Jack-Wilshare.png)
Started as one of the brightest and talent young player at Arsenal, but his career was faced with several injuries. A stunning performance against Barcelona hinted at his potential greatness, but 1470 days lost to injury made him looked like he was forgotten.
Despite 18 different injuries and missing 214 games, Wilshere’s career path was overshadowed by continuous physical setbacks, leading to his retirement at just 30 years old.

3. Arjen Robben
The kings of Champions League football, Arjen Robben electrifying pace and accurate left foot was loved by the fans during his stints with Chelsea and Bayern Munich.
However, injuries, totaling 58 over his career, saw him miss 243 matches. Even with these challenges, Robben’s talent saw him contribute amazingly to Bayern’s success, including eight Bundesliga titles and a Champions League triumph.

1. Abou Diaby
![Top 10 most injury player](https://footballdebates.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/07/Abou-Diaby.png)
Abou Diaby is the most suffered injury player, it was a fight fot fitness for the French player. With a serious 1747 days lost to injury and 21 different issues, Diaby’s career path with Arsenal and Marseille was defined by serious injuries that takes him for a long period of time.
